## Local Setup: Export Retry Worker

The Tarnwell retry worker re-queues failed exports from the `export_failures` table with exponential backoff capped at six attempts. For review purposes, run `scripts/seed_failures.sh` to create representative rows, then start the worker with `bin/retryd --once` so each pass is deterministic and easy to inspect. Verify that permanently failed rows are marked, not deleted. The worker reads its source database via the connection string below.

database URL for tajog-bajeg: mysql://soreth_svc:OzsCjhu@db-6997.nelvrostack.internal:5432/kelax

Finance Review Summary — Plustier Launch

The new Atalon Plus subscription tier closed its first full quarter with 4,200 activations, slightly ahead of the modeled 3,900. Average revenue per subscriber rose 11%, while churn held steady at 2.3%. Branch-level upsell performance varied widely; the Merrowfield and Dunkettle branches led conversion, and underperforming branches will receive revised scripts in Q3. Margins remain within target despite onboarding costs. Before circulating these figures further, note the confidential guidance below.

internal memo for yahag-tahog: The pricing group signed off on a budget of $152.8 million for Project Soriel.

## Session Handling for Health Checks

The Corvel gateway sits behind the Lanternside load balancer, which probes /healthz every ten seconds. Health-check requests are stateless by design: they bypass the session store entirely so that probe traffic never inflates session counts or evicts real user sessions. New team members should note that the deep-check endpoint, /healthz/deep, does verify session-store connectivity and therefore requires authentication. When probing it manually, supply the token below.

bearer token for tajep-kajef: eyJhbGciOiJIUzI1NiIsInR5cCI6IkpXVCJ9.eyJzdWIiOiIoOsZ23In0.CsygO0hs